INGLEWOOD, Calif. — The Oklahoma City Thunder continued their dominant start to the 2025–26 NBA season, defeating the Los Angeles Clippers 126–107 on Monday night at the Intuit Dome to remain the league’s only undefeated team at 8–0.
Shai Shines at Intuit Dome
Shai Gilgeous-Alexander once again proved why he’s one of the brightest stars in the NBA, leading the Thunder with 30 points and 12 assists, orchestrating the offense with precision and poise. Isaiah Joe added 22 points off the bench, stretching the floor with timely three-pointers that kept OKC’s momentum alive throughout the second half.
The Clippers came out strong in front of their home crowd, jumping to an early lead behind James Harden’s hot shooting, as the veteran guard knocked down five three-pointers in the first half and finished with 25 points. However, Los Angeles’ offense cooled off after halftime as the Thunder tightened their defense and surged ahead with a 38-20 third quarter.
Despite solid of James Harden in the first quarter, the Clippers couldn’t contain OKC’s balanced attack and fast-paced rhythm. The loss drops Los Angeles to 3–4 on the season as they continue to find their chemistry early in the campaign.
The Thunder, meanwhile, continue their impressive streak, showing no signs of slowing down as they extend their perfect record to 8–0 — the NBA’s last remaining unbeaten squad.
